13897
13898
13899
13900
13901
13902
13903
13904
13905
13906
13907
13908
ГОСТ Р ИСО/МЭК 26300—2010
tional»
«/optional»
«optional»
«attribute nar»e-"atyle: font-size-reI-aeian">
<tef name-"length"/»
«/attribute»
«/optional»
«op
«attribute na»e-"atyie:font-aize-rel-coeiplexe>
<xef name-"length"/»
«/attribute»
«/optional»
«/define»
15.4.21 Тип скрипта
Свойство
style: script-type
можетиспользоватьсядляуказания
атрибутов,связанныхстипомскрипта(например.
fo: font-family,
style:for.t-family-asian,style:font-family-complex),
активныхв
настоящеевремядлянекотороготекста.Атрибутдолженвычисляться
приложениями, которые не поддерживают типы скриптов, чтобы установить
свойства, обусловленные типами скриптов. Приложение, поддерживающее типы
скриптов,такжеможет интерпретировать атрибути переопределять тип,
используемый для некоторых символов, но не обязательно.
Использование данного свойства упрощает преобразования из/в (CSS2J/
(XSL) и другие форматы, не поддерживающие атрибутов, связанных с типами
скриптов. Данное свойство может использоваться также для применения типов
скриптов для (UNICODE) символов, там где приложение может выбрать различные
типы скриптов.
Значениями данного свойства могут быть
latin, asian, complex
и
ignore.
Значение
ignore
может быть использовано только со стилями по умолчанию.
Если оно установлено, атрибуты, связанные с типами скриптов, применяются ко
всем типам скриптов. Это может, например, означать, что
fo:font-family
будет
применен ко всем типам скриптов, также как
style:font-family-asian
или
style:for.t-family-complex.
Этоупрощаетсохранениедокументовиз
приложений, не поддерживающих тип скрипта.
13909
«define name-"atyle-text-propertles-attlist" corabine-"interleave">
13910
«optional»
1
1
3
3
9
9
1
1
1
2
«att
«
ri
c
b
h
u
o
t
ic
e
e»
name-"style:ecript-type">
13913
<value»latin</value>
1
1
3
3
9
9
1
1
4
5
<
<v
v
a
a
l
l
u
u
e
e
»
»
c
a
o
a
m
ia
p
n
l
«
e
/
x
v
«
a
/
l
v
u
a
e
lu
>
e»
681